Tupende Wazee


Am I repeating myself? If so, sorry!

I just love this photo of the seniors' group supported by Together Building Africa! 

This was a vision of Mapendo's. Seniors suffer from poverty, stress, and loss of loved ones. Many of them have inadequate accommodation.  The building we rent has a couple of rooms that can be used as a shelter when there is a need.

In this photo, they are celebrating the gift of new clothes. They were each given a comforter and some material, for Christmas. They were overwhelmed and so thankful.

This is the kind of help we are able to provide because of the support you give.

One day, as I was walking past their meeting place, they rushed over to surround me and sing a song. Such a special moment. Wish you were there!
